Roof construction techniques have evolved considerably over time, pushed by advancements in materials and modifications in building codes and architectural styles. Understanding these techniques is crucial for builders, architects, and householders alike, as they provide the structural framework needed to ensure durability, aesthetic appeal, and vitality efficiency.




One of essentially the most elementary features of roof construction is the choice of materials. Whether a roof is flat, pitched, or curved, the choice between materials such as asphalt shingles, metal sheets, tiles, or membranes plays a crucial position in the total efficiency of the roof. Each material comes with its own set of advantages and disadvantages that may affect each the preliminary prices and long-term maintenance.

Traditional asphalt shingles stay the most popular alternative in residential roofing for their affordability and big selection of styles. They are simple to install and could be applied over present roofing, making them a practical choice for many householders. However, they could not last as lengthy as other materials and can be weak to weather-related harm if not installed properly.


Metal roofing has gained recognition because of its longevity and resistance to harsh weather circumstances. Available in various colors and kinds, metal roofs can improve a constructing's aesthetic whereas offering phenomenal vitality efficiency. Their installation involves interlocking panels that create a watertight seal. The only disadvantage is that metal roofing usually has the next initial cost than asphalt shingles, although they will save on vitality prices over time.


Tile roofing is another approach that has stood the test of time. Clay and concrete tiles supply a novel look and might last over 50 years with correct maintenance. They are extremely resistant to fire, insects, and decay. However, their weight requires a sturdy supporting structure, which can lead to higher construction costs.


Flat roofs current a special problem due to their design. Common in commercial architecture, flat roofs can make the most of materials corresponding to rubberized membranes, modified bitumen, or built-up roofing. Adequate drainage systems are crucial to forestall water pooling, as standing water can result in leaks and structural points.

The insulation and ventilation elements are important in roof construction strategies. Proper insulation can help keep utility costs down and improve comfort inside the building. Ventilation, on the other hand, permits for air circulation and prevents moisture buildup, mitigating the dangers of mildew and mildew. Roof vents and soffit vents are frequent strategies for reaching correct airflow.


Interestingly, modern roofing systems typically incorporate photo voltaic panels and green roofs as sustainable building solutions. Solar panels may be integrated through the initial construction part, permitting for power generation right from the start. Green roofs, which involve planting vegetation on a water-resistant membrane, provide natural insulation and may even assist in stormwater management.


When considering roof construction, climate must not be missed. Different geographic areas experience various weather patterns, which can drastically affect roof integrity. For occasion, areas vulnerable to heavy snow may require steeper pitches to facilitate snow shedding, lowering the risk of structural collapse. Similarly, hurricane-prone regions should adhere to strict building codes that specify wind-resistant materials and methods.


The craftsmanship of roof installation is equally important. Experienced roofing contractors will understand the nuances of making use of varied materials correctly. Poor set up practices can compromise even the most durable materials, leading to leaks, decreased energy effectivity, visit this page and a shortened lifespan for the roof.

As technology continues to evolve, progressive construction methods are emerging. Drones, for instance, at the second are being utilized for inspections, permitting for safer and quicker assessments of roof circumstances. Advances in material science are also leading to the development of light-weight and highly durable roofing merchandise that can revolutionize traditional practices.


Fire security codes also play a notable position in figuring out roofing strategies. Fire-resistant materials are obligatory in sure conditions, especially in wildfire-prone areas. The application of Class A rated materials can drastically cut back the danger associated with fireplace harm and enhance total safety.

Maintaining a roof is important for its longevity and efficiency. Regular inspections can catch points earlier than they escalate into major problems. Homeowners should be encouraged to schedule periodic checks, notably after severe climate occasions. Simple tasks like cleansing gutters and eradicating debris can also extend a roof's life.
